Abstract

The method of auditory system design based on time difference is proposed. According to the special character of sound signal and basic need of collection technology, it had been explored to the microphone choice and the signal pretreatment. Sound source position is calculated by the tetrahedron array of four microphones, cross-correlation method is used to count delay. Experiment results show that the design can make the robot locate the azimuth of the sound source accurately and is practical enough for real-time operation.
